
A violent incident unfolded in the Bronx earlier last month when a 66-year-old man, sitting in his vehicle, was attacked by an assailant wielding a knife. The assault, which took place on June 2 at approximately 11:30 AM near 2772 3rd Avenue, left the elderly victim with a serious injury to his left hand after the assailant demanded money and then slashed him.
The New York Police Department has turned to the public for help, issuing a plea via their Crime Stoppers social media account for any information that might lead to the apprehension of the suspect involved in this robbery and assault case; they encouraged individuals who might know something to direct message them @nypdtips or call their hotline at 1-800-577-TIPS (8477), this outreach effort reflects both the gravity of the attack and the need for community assistance in solving the case.
